BRYNDOLAU, ABERGWESYN, BUILTH WELLS
Situated in the picturesque Gwesyn Valley, a beautifully located four bedroomed country cottage with extensively landscaped gardens amounting to around 0.75 of an acre.
ENTRANCE HALL, LIVING ROOM, KITCHEN/DINING ROOM, STUDY, UTILITY ROOM, SHOWER ROOM, FOUR BEDROOMS, EN SUITE, BATHROOM.
Bryndolau is an impressive 4 bedroom stone country cottage, believed to date back to around 1894. It offers enormous character and charm with period features including original Victorian fireplaces and cupboards, and has been sensitively modernised by the current vendors to provide a wonderful country home in an unspoilt rural position. It is complimented by generous sized gardens and a detached double garage.
It is situated in a stunning position within the Gwesyn Valley with far reaching views and yet is accessible by the surrounding country lanes.
The property is approximately 6 miles from Llanwrtyd Wells, 12 miles from the market town of Builth Wells, 15 miles from Llandovery and 5 miles from Beulah which has a petrol station/stores. Builth Wells is the nearest town with a range of amenities including shops, primary and high schools, hospital, cinema/arts centre and a range of leisure facilities and is home to the Royal Welsh Showground.
